Most of us recognized that 2009 started off as a very slow year. Buyer's were nervous and their savings had been decimated or worse. But the real estate market started to bounce back in March. The Total number of home sales on the Toronto Real Estate Board's MLS® system in March, April and May 2009 were only slightly lower than the 2008 numbers, before the markets started to slow down.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Real estate was far hotter, this summer, than the weather. June 2009 set an all time record for most homes sold, in the month of June, with 10,955 home sold. July was only just short of 10,000 home and August put in a very respectable 8,035 home sales. This compared with 2007 is only 24 less than the number of homes sold, in the Greater Toronto Area, for August and the average sale price was up over $26,000 from August 2007 to August 2009 at $387,921.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;This year there have been more sales in the first 8 months that in the same month for 2008 despite the sluggish start. September is shaping up to be another good month for home sales with over 3,300 sales in the first half with an average sale price of $393,818.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;This is proof that the Toronto area real estate markets have weathered the global downturn and that there never was a bubble in our prices. What we experienced last fall and winter was due to people being nervous about the economy, mainly the American economy, and the possible outcomes of the US election. And they may, however any price decrease should be minimal and short lived. The one thing that is going against the real estate markets in the Toronto area, including Richmond Hill, Aurora and all of York Region, is low consumer confidence. Unfortunately this low consumer confidence issue is mostly unsubstantiated. Yes the stock market has had a major correction and the DOW Jones looks like an EKG chart but most of the economic factors that support a strong real estate market are still here.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;One of the biggest misconceptions currently going around is that the real estate markets have slowed down to the point of being a strong buyer's market. It is true that the number of sales in 2008 are lower that 2007 and even a little off of 2006 numbers. However, historically speaking the sales volume is still very high. A great analogy for our market sales was given at the Toronto Real Estate Board's annual general meeting on Monday Oct 27th. It was that the 2007 real estate sales were like driving on the 401 at 150 clicks (obviously not during rush hour) and now we have slowed down to 120 Kph. We are still moving very fast but it seems slow compared to what we were going. As it is the Toronto area real estate markets are still aiming for about 80,000 sales in 2008 which is a volume that was only reached starting in 2004, so historically still very high.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;They also talk about rising inventory levels. However the inventory levels in the Toronto real estate markets is still under 4 months supply. This means that if no new homes are put on the market and sales remained the same it would only take 4 months to run out of available homes. This is well within the range that indicates a balanced market not a buyer's market. So unlike some areas in the U.S.A where there are as many as 12 months supply, we are far from over stocked in homes. We may not see huge increases in price this year but if people don't panic then we also should not see major price reductions, except on homes that are over priced to start with.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Other factors to consider are mortgage rates which are still very low, and unlike some areas of the U.S.A. mortgages are still readily available here in Canada. Speaking of mortgages, our banking systems are much different here in Canada when compared to the U.S.A. and as a result are in a much stronger position than their counterparts south of the boarder.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Also consider that unemployment is still very low, and the rate of foreclosure is only about 0.25% according to CMHC as compared to 1992 when it was close to 6% and currently in the States where foreclosure rates are close to 20%. It is believed that the number of speculative buyers is significantly lower than back in 1989 so that should not be a huge flood of homes on the market especially since our rental markets are still very strong. We also still have a large volume of new immigrants into the Toronto areas, creating demand for homes both in the rental and purchasing sectors.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;All in all our economy is healthy but it is being rattled around by uncertainty. This means that first time home buyers can now save up to $2,000 on a resale home purchase.  The legislation for this rebate has not yet been passed, but any first time home buyer that enters into an "agreement to purchase and sale" on or after December 13th, 2007 is entitled to a rebate of up to $2,000 once the legislation is passed.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The City of Toronto has also up dated their new land transfer tax so that first time home buyers should not have to pay the land transfer tax on the first $400,000 of their home purchase at all.  Previously any first time home buyer who is buying a home that is priced over $400,000 had to pay the full tax up front and then get a rebate for the tax paid on the first $400,000.  Under their new system, which they hope to have in place before Feb 1st 2008 when the tax starts, first time home buyers will be able to pay only the tax owing on the balance of the purchase price minus $400,000.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;Looking for a

So until the home inspection industry gets its own version of REBBA making it illegal to charge a fee for a home inspection related service, without first being registered and insured, how do you choose the right home inspector?&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;I think we would all recognize that this picture would be of someone you would not like to have inspecting your home, yet home inspectors are rarely this obviously unqualified. So, always make sure that they are a member of the Canadian Association of Home and Property Inspectors (CAHPI) and in Ontario, Canada, they should also belong to the Ontario Association of Home Inspectors (OAHI). These two organizations have their own rules, regulations, ethics codes and training qualifications that must be met in order to remain a member.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Make sure that they have errors and omission insurance that is up to date and paid for, just in case they do miss something that should have been detected. I believe that Insurance coverage is a requirement for both of the above organizations, however it is best to ask and even to see an insurance policy "slip" stating that the insurance coverage is valid and active.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;In Ontario, Canada, all REALTORS® must advise their clients that a home inspection is recommended service. Most will even give you a few names to choose from. You should call at least 2-3 home inspectors and interview them to find out what they do and how much they charge. Some may provide extra services for a premium or use specialized equipment that goes beyond a basic home inspection. You can expect to pay close to $400 for a home inspection on a home up to 2,500sq ft if it is not too old. Older homes may cost more as they often need to be home thoroughly inspected and my have crawl spaces and awkward spaces that the home inspector needs to get into to inspect the home. Larger homes will often cost more as there is more home to inspect and it will take longer and may even involve multiple heating and ventilation systems or other home systems that are included in the inspection.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;As Part of my &lt;a href="http://www.andrewhodgerealtor.com/"&gt;York Region real estate service&lt;/a&gt; I have several home inspectors that I recommend to my clients based on how thorough they are. The Government of Canada has passed Bill C37 which changes the minimum loan to value amounts for conventional mortgages.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;What does this mean to you?  In the past if you were borrowing more than 75% of the purchase price, or value of the property, you had to get CMHC or Genworth mortgage insurance.  Now that Loan to Value amount has changed so that there is no need for high ratio mortgage insurance if you are borrowing less than 80% of the homes value.  This move will save you a large chunk of change (over a thousand dollars) if you can come up with a 20%  downpayment.  For those that had been saving up to have a 25% downpayment and avoid the insurance premium, you can now put 20% down on a larger or better home, or spend the extra 5% on furniture, upgrades or savings.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;Looking for a

This is a commonly asked questions and the answer is not as cut and dry as I would like. &l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;In Ontario, Canada, the basic answer is that the deposit stays in the trust account until the buyer and the seller can come to an agreement on how it is to be dispersed, or until there is a court order stating how it will be dispersed.  In most cases the funds are given to the party that still wants to close the sale, in this question that would be the seller, however it is not guaranteed.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;So if the buyer backs our of the real estate deal they have two options.  They can sign a mutual release noting that all or part of deposit is to be dispersed to the seller.  Or they can let it go to court and have the courts decide how it will be released.  In the first case the seller has to agree but the seller may be giving up any rights to further actions against the buyer should they not be able to sell the home without incurring a loss (relative to the original agreement).  Going through the courts though will take more time and lawyer fees but may end up with the seller (in this case) getting more money or compensation.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Always consult your lawyer before signing anything regarding&lt;/strong&gt; a non-mutually agreeable &lt;strong&gt;disposition of the trust funds&lt;/strong&gt;.  ie if you are less that comfortable with what you are being asked to sign or the outcome will be anything that is less than your preferred outcome, talk to a lawyer.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;As for the agents, the they only get paid if the sale closes or if their client is the party that is backing out and the other party still wants to close.  So in the case above the seller's agent would not be paid but the Buyer's agent could bill the buyer for the commission that they would have earned had the buyer not breached the purchase agreement (pending any adjustments in the listing or purchase agreement, which does not happen often).  REALTORS® get paid for results, unless you are using a flat fee service that is paid up front, and the only result that counts is the final sale and closing.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;As a seller, if the buyer backs out, it would be nice to compensate your agent for the hard work, frustration and disappointment involved with a sale going sour.  However, there is nothing in the standard forms that give the agent any claim to compensation so long as the sale does not close as a result of the other party.  If both parties decide not to close and agree to a mutual release then non of the agents get paid.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;Looking for a

This is on top of the existing Land Transfer Tax that is levied by the Ontario government. Under the powers that were recently given to the City of Toronto, under the new City of Toronto Act, you could be required to pay an additional 0.5% of the purchase price in the form of a land transfer tax if you purchase a home in the boundaries of the City of Toronto.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;This means that the average home (approx. $380,000 in Toronto for 2006) will cost an extra $1,900 that can not be put into the mortgage, according to the Toronto Real Estate Board. However, the average sale price for a home in February, in the central districts on the Toronto MLS® system, was $504,381 which would mean an extra tax of $2,521.91.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;So how is this likely to effect your home's value? It could undermine the &lt;a href="http://www.AndrewHodgeREALTOR.com"&gt;Toronto real estate &lt;/a&gt;markets. If you are in the upper end of homes the effects may not be &lt;em&gt;initially&lt;/em&gt; visible, although it will make homes outside of the Toronto boundaries a lot more attractive. However, if your home is best suited for a first time home buyer then this will hit your bottom line.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;A large number of first time home buyers are purchasing their home with only 5% down and a 95% mortgage. Even with this amount of leveraging they are often pressed to make the 5% and all of their closing costs. Some buyers are even getting 100% mortgages. If the buyer for your home (asking $300,000) has to take $1,500 out of their down payment to cover extra closing costs this will decrease their buying power by $30,000 (if $1,500 = 5% then 100% =$30,000). Since this will effect all homes and all buyers this is &lt;strong&gt;likely to decrease the value of your home by 10%&lt;/strong&gt;.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;You will also see fewer home sales as people who are using the 100% mortgage programs will have to wait longer to save up their closing costs. This could see a trend to have the seller paying for the buyer's closing costs, like you see in the USA sometimes, however that may be seen as a form of mortgage fraud depending on how you interpret the payment.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;This effect on lower cost housing may dramatically effect the second home and luxury home markets. As people may need to stay in their "first step" home longer in order to save up the equity to pay for the extra closing costs. Which could take a long time if their property value drops 10% due to the introduction of this transfer tax. This could lead to a higher percentage of 95% mortgages on second home which could cause the prices in those markets to also fall by as much as 10%.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The bottom line is that a simple &lt;strong&gt;0.5% land transfer tax will undermine the affordability of homes in Toronto,&lt;/strong&gt; which is already one of the highest priced cities in Canada. Property values will get undermined, along with affordability, causing your property to lose value, which will decrease the number of sales in the Toronto area.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Studies have shown that every resale home causes around $27,000 in spin off spending. This would be for anything from new appliances to renovations. All of which generates taxes as well as boosting the economy. If the number of home sales decreases because of a newly created tax then the Toronto economy will be effected as well as the taxes that are generated through those purchases.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;So what can you do? It is divided into three sections, North East corner of Yonge and Jefferson Sdrd, and extension of the Kings Hill development off of Bathurst and South of Augustine Ave and the yet to be built North West corner of Jefferson and Bathurst.  This is in the Oak Ridges area of Richmond Hill and is in the N05 MLS® district on the Toronto MLS® system.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;In between the three areas of residential homes, in the Macleod's Landing, you will find a large conservation area with trails connecting all three areas.  There is also a golf course (Bathurst Glen) which is now the property of the town of Town of Richmond Hill and offers very reasonable prices for greens fees and its driving range.  This land is zoned as "Linkage land" and will not be built on, so long as the governing bodies continue to value the environment and Oak Ridges conservation laws and the Greenbelt laws are in effect.  Even the Golf course can only be changed to park or conservation land and if it is, it cannot be changed back under current laws.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Within the Macleod's Landing linkage lands there are several small lakes, forested areas and fields where wild life is health and active.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Currently there are 38 homes on the real estate markets. These are both examples of why statistics are dangerous.  Although it is true that the average sale price in Aurora, Ontario, was down by a whopping 12.8% that does not mean that the average home has lost 12.8% of its value.  It only means that the home buyers that were active enough to purchase homes, in January 2007, were looking for homes that were (on average) 12.8% lower in price than those looking in 2006.  So more homes in lower price ranges sold and fewer of the higher priced homes sold.  In February we may see far more of the $600,000 plus homes sell and the average sale price could jump to $500,000 or more.  All because the home buyers in that price range may be chaffing at not having found the right home in January and so those sales may tip the scale in the opposite direction.  Either way the value of the average home is not nearly as volatile as the average home sale price.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;"Lies, damn lies and statistics" I can never remember which famous person said it but it is still true. It has now been replaced with the &lt;a href="http://www.e-laws.gov.on.ca/html/statutes/english/elaws_statutes_06r17_e.htm"&gt;Residential Tenancies Act&lt;/a&gt; with a few significant changes.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;First, in the old act tenants were entitled to 6% interest on there last months rent per year payable each year. Now the interest has been reduced to the same as the consumer price index which will also be used in determining the rent increase amounts that landlords can charge yearly. This will, within reason , make a last months rent always equal the last months rent no matter how long you stay in the unit.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Landlords will now be allowed to inspect the unit for maintenance problems with 24 hours and the process for evicting tenants that have damaged their rental property ( either themselves or their guests) have been made easier. So be kind to your rental unit.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The Ontario Rental Housing Tribunal has been given a new name and there are supposed to be improvements to the process of dealing with issues between landlords and tenants. This new entity is called the Landlord and Tenant Board.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;If you are, or want to be, a landlord or tenant you should read the new act and know your rights. A customer service agreement is a disclosure form that formalizes and clarifies that the REALTOR®, that you are using, is NOT working for you.  Instead they are providing customer service which includes fair and honest treatment, factual information about the property that is not visibly evident (latent defects) and answers that have properly thought about before responding to them (they have to answer any questions about the condition of the property, as you ask them).&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;With a customer service agreement you are "unrepresented" and in a "buyer beware" situation.  If you walk into an open house and want to buy that house using the listing agent then this is the relationship that the REALTOR® should be working towards unless you request representation and the seller agrees to allowing their agent to enter into a dual representation situation (or you get representation from another REALTOR® at a different brokerage).&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Buyer Representation Agreements on the other hand state that the REALTOR® is working for you and that you are bound to that REALTOR® for the term of the agreement with a holdover period.  In this case you receive fiduciary duties, from the REALTOR® and all of the agents at the brokerage that they work for, that protects your information and interests.  Unless you have an agreement from the REALTOR® that you may terminate your agreement then you are bound to the terms of the agreement until the agreements term has passed.  If you do not like the agent you are using you can ask to terminate the agreement or to have it transferred to another REALTOR®, but there is no obligation on the REALTOR® to do so unless they have not followed the terms of the contract.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Both of these "agreements" are designed with the purpose of protecting and informing the purchaser of their rights and obligations.  Part of protecting you, for a REALTOR®, is protecting your personal information which can only be done if you are not giving that information to other REALTORS® and sellers in the area.  With the representation agreement there is usually a guaranteed minimum commission for the agent stated so that the agent will be compensated for the work they do, if you decide to buy a home in the term of the agreement.  However, there is nothing in the Buyer Representation Agreement that states that you have to buy anything.  It only states that if you buy a home that you will use this particular brokerage and that they will be compensated for the service provided.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;So please remember a "customer service agreement" means "Buyer Beware".&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Have questions call me, post your question as a comment in any of my blogs postings (I will answer it with a new post) or you can contact me through any of my websites including &lt;a href="http://www.AndrewHodgeREALTOR.com"&gt;www.AndrewHodgeREALTOR.com&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Happy House Hunting&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Andrew Hodge&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;Looking for a
